package com.google.api.ads.dfa.lib.client;

import com.google.api.ads.common.lib.auth.OAuth2Compatible;
import com.google.api.ads.common.lib.client.AdsSession;
import com.google.api.ads.common.lib.client.Endpoint;
import com.google.api.ads.common.lib.conf.ConfigurationHelper;
import com.google.api.ads.common.lib.conf.ConfigurationLoadException;
import com.google.api.ads.common.lib.exception.ValidationException;
import com.google.api.client.auth.oauth2.Credential;
import com.google.common.annotations.VisibleForTesting;

import org.apache.commons.configuration.Configuration;

import java.io.File;
import java.net.MalformedURLException;
import java.net.URL;

/**
 * A {@code DfaSession} represents a single session of DFA use.
 *
 * 

* Implementation is not thread-safe. *

* * @author Adam Rogal */ public class DfaSession implements AdsSession, OAuth2Compatible { /** * Enum representing the endpoint server, aka environment. * @author Kevin Winter */ public static enum Environment implements Endpoint { PRODUCTION("https://advertisersapi.doubleclick.net"), TEST("https://advertisersapitest.doubleclick.net"); private final String endpoint; private Environment(String endpoint) { this.endpoint = endpoint; } /** * @return the endpoint */ public String getEndpoint() { return endpoint; } } private String username; private String password; private String authenticationToken; private String applicationName; private String endpoint; private Credential oAuth2Credential; /** * Default constructor. */ private DfaSession() { super(); } /** * Copy constructor. */ private DfaSession(DfaSession copy) { this.applicationName = copy.applicationName; this.authenticationToken = copy.authenticationToken; this.endpoint = copy.endpoint; this.password = copy.password; this.username = copy.username; this.oAuth2Credential = copy.oAuth2Credential; } /** * Sets the token associated with this session. */ public void setToken(String token) { this.authenticationToken = token; } /** * Gets the user name. */ public String getUsername() { return username; } /** * Gets the password. */ public String getPassword() { return password; } /** * Gets the token used for authentication. */ public String getToken() { return authenticationToken; } /** * Gets the application name. */ public String getApplicationName() { return applicationName; } /** * @return the endpoint */ public String getEndpoint() { return endpoint; } /** * Determines if the session is for the supplied * {@link DfaSession.Environment}. */ public boolean isEnvironment(Endpoint environment) { return environment.getEndpoint().equals(this.endpoint); } /** * Gets the OAuth2 credentials. */ public Credential getOAuth2Credential() { return oAuth2Credential; } /** * Builder for DfaSession. * *

* Implementation is not thread-safe. *

*/ public static class Builder implements com.google.api.ads.common.lib.utils.Builder { private DfaSession dfaSession; private String environmentString; @VisibleForTesting ConfigurationHelper configHelper; @VisibleForTesting Builder(ConfigurationHelper helper) { this.dfaSession = new DfaSession(); this.configHelper = helper; } /** * Constructor. */ public Builder() { this.dfaSession = new DfaSession(); this.configHelper = new ConfigurationHelper(); } public Builder fromFile() throws ConfigurationLoadException { return fromFile(Builder.DEFAULT_CONFIGURATION_FILENAME); } public Builder fromFile(String path) throws ConfigurationLoadException { return from(configHelper.fromFile(path)); } public Builder fromFile(File path) throws ConfigurationLoadException { return from(configHelper.fromFile(path)); } public Builder fromFile(URL path) throws ConfigurationLoadException { return from(configHelper.fromFile(path)); } /** * Reads properties from the provided {@link Configuration} object.

* Known properties: *
    *
  • api.dfa.username
  • *
  • api.dfa.password
  • *
  • api.dfa.applicationName
  • *
  • api.dfa.token
  • *
  • api.dfa.environment, e.g. production or test
  • *
* * @param config * @return Builder populated from the Configuration */ public Builder from(Configuration config) { dfaSession.username = config.getString("api.dfa.username", null); dfaSession.password = config.getString("api.dfa.password", null); dfaSession.applicationName = config.getString("api.dfa.applicationName", null); dfaSession.authenticationToken = config.getString("api.dfa.token", null); dfaSession.endpoint = config.getString("api.dfa.endpoint", null); environmentString = config.getString("api.dfa.environment", null); return this; } /** * Includes the specified environment, e.g. * {@link Environment#TEST} * * The environment and endpoint in DFA are currently synonymous. Setting an * environment will clear out any endpoint you have previously set. */ public Builder withEnvironment(Environment environment) { dfaSession.endpoint = environment.getEndpoint(); environmentString = null; return this; } /** * Override the endpoint server. * * The environment and endpoint in DFA are currently synonymous. Setting an * endpoint will clear out any environment you have previously set. */ public Builder withEndpoint(String endpoint) { dfaSession.endpoint = endpoint; environmentString = null; return this; } /** * Includes username and password. */ public Builder withUsernameAndPassword(String username, String password) { dfaSession.username = username; dfaSession.password = password; return this; } /** * Includes a username with a hard-coded token to be used instead of * fetching a new one. */ public Builder withUsernameAndToken(String username, String token) { dfaSession.username = username; dfaSession.authenticationToken = token; return this; } /** * Includes a username with an OAuth2 credential used for generating DFA * tokens. */ public Builder withUsernameAndOAuth2Credential(String username, Credential credential) { dfaSession.username = username; dfaSession.oAuth2Credential = credential; return this; } /** * Includes an OAuth2 credential. * * **WARNING** You should only use this method if your username is being * pulled in by {@link #fromFile()}. Otherwise, you should use * {@link #withUsernameAndOAuth2Credential(String, Credential)} */ public Builder withOAuth2Credential(Credential credential) { dfaSession.oAuth2Credential = credential; return this; } /** * Includes application name. */ public Builder withApplicationName(String applicationName) { dfaSession.applicationName = applicationName; return this; } /** * Builds the {@code DfaSession}. * @return the built {@code DfaSession} * @throws ValidationException if the {@code DfaSession} did not validate */ public DfaSession build() throws ValidationException { validate(dfaSession); return new DfaSession(dfaSession); } /** * Validates the DFA session. */ private void validate(DfaSession dfaSession) throws ValidationException { if (environmentString != null) { try { withEnvironment(Environment.valueOf(environmentString.toUpperCase())); } catch (IllegalArgumentException e) { throw new ValidationException(String.format("Environment [%s] not recognized.", environmentString), "api.dfa.environment", e); } } // Check for valid username. if (dfaSession.getUsername() == null) { throw new ValidationException("Username is required.", "username"); } boolean usingPassword = dfaSession.getPassword() != null; boolean usingToken = dfaSession.getToken() != null; boolean usingOAuth2 = dfaSession.getOAuth2Credential() != null; // Check that at least one auth mechanism is being use. if (!usingPassword && !usingToken && !usingOAuth2) { throw new ValidationException( "One of username/password, username/token or username/OAuth2 must be used.", ""); } // Check that only one auth mechanism is being used. if ((usingPassword && usingToken) || (usingPassword && usingOAuth2) || (usingToken && usingOAuth2)) { throw new ValidationException( "You may only use one of username/password, username/token, and username/OAuth2 at " + "the same time.", ""); } // Make sure they specify an environment. try { new URL(dfaSession.getEndpoint()); } catch (MalformedURLException e) { throw new ValidationException("Endpoint is required and must be a valid URL.", "endpoint", e); } } } }
